I had the good fortune...
By Fiona S.

of seeing Hanson in performance at the Riverfest in Tulsa, OK this past weekend! It was so wonderful to see them, and totally worth the 8 hour drive from Houston with my boyfriend and the one speeding ticket (my first!) that I received on an OK highway. The heat was terrible, so it was nice of the roadies for spraying the crowd with water throughout the day. The other bands were pretty good and Admiral Twin rocked!! Everybody who came on stage before Hanson kept mentioning them and thus evoking crazed screams from all of us :)

When Hanson finally came out (they were late as usual) the crowd started pushing and shoving something terrible! It was awful. I saw one little girl and her mom starting to leave cause the little girl was getting hurt by the crowd.

I'm happy that I was able to see Hanson, though. They sounded amazing! Taylor was his eternally charismatic self, Ike was so cool on his guitar and Zac seemed to be having a great time. He laughed a lot those 30 minutes. I think their instruments kept messing up cause they had gotten wet from the spraying.

Hanson performed 7 songs: "Lonely Again", "Sure About It", "Wish that I was There", "MMMBop", "If Only" and two new songs that sounded just awesome. I can't wait for the new album!! I got some really good pics too, whoop de doo! Taylor and Zac sprayed the crowd when they were done, then they were gone. I was so excited to have seen them again!
